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of ink printing technology, specifically to an ink printing device with adjustable printing thickness. Background Technology

[0002] In the field of ink printing technology, precise control of printing thickness directly affects the appearance quality, color uniformity, and functional performance of printed materials (such as the conductivity of conductive inks and the recognizability of anti-counterfeiting inks). However, existing ink printing devices have many technical limitations in practical applications. For example, the squeegee angle of traditional printing devices is mostly fixed and cannot be flexibly adjusted according to ink viscosity, substrate material (such as paper, plastic, and metal), or printing pattern requirements. If the printing thickness needs to be changed, the squeegee or shim must be manually disassembled and replaced, which is not only time-consuming and labor-intensive, but also makes it difficult to achieve precise control of minute angles, resulting in poor printing thickness consistency and problems such as missing prints and excessive accumulation. [0008]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are: 1. The scraper assembly adopts a "drive motor + worm gear" transmission structure. The worm gear transmission has the characteristics of self-locking (which can prevent the scraper angle from changing on its own due to external force) and large reduction ratio, which can realize the small incremental adjustment of the scraper angle. Combined with the electric push rod to quantitatively adjust the scraper pressure, the ink transfer amount can be precisely controlled to meet the printing needs of different thicknesses.

[0009] 2. The vacuum adsorption structure of the substrate platform adsorbs the substrate through uniformly distributed vacuum adsorption holes. Compared with traditional mechanical clamps, it can apply a more uniform fixing force and avoid substrate wrinkling or local deformation. At the same time, negative pressure adsorption can adapt to substrates of different sizes and materials, effectively solving the problem of substrate displacement during printing. [0014] Combination Figures 1 to 4 The ink printing device with adjustable printing thickness shown includes a worktable 1. A two-axis moving mechanism is provided on the top of the worktable 1. The two-axis moving mechanism includes a vertical moving component 2 that moves in the Z-axis direction and a horizontal moving component 3 that moves in the X-axis direction. Both the vertical moving component 2 and the horizontal moving component 3 are moved by a lead screw transmission mechanism, which is a commonly used two-axis moving method in the prior art. The two ends of the sliding guide rail 31 of the transverse moving component 3 are connected to the screen printing plate 5 via the connecting plate 4. One end of the moving plate 32 of the transverse moving component 3 is connected to the mounting plate 6. Two electric push rods 7 are installed on the top of the mounting plate 6. One end of the telescopic rod of the two electric push rods 7 is connected to the scraper assembly 8 and the ink return plate assembly 9 respectively. The worktable 1 below the screen printing plate 5 is provided with a substrate platform 10. The vertical moving component 2 drives the horizontal moving component 3 to move up and down as a whole through the lead screw transmission mechanism, adjusting the vertical distance between the screen printing plate 5 and the substrate on the substrate platform 10, ensuring that the ink can be accurately transferred from the screen printing plate mesh to the substrate surface, and avoiding missing prints due to excessive distance or damage to the substrate due to insufficient distance.

[0015] The printing platform 10 has a cavity inside, and multiple vacuum adsorption holes 101 are evenly distributed on the top surface of the platform. The cavity of the printing platform 10 is connected to an external vacuum generator through a connecting air pipe to provide negative pressure to the platform. During printing, the substrate to be printed, such as paper or plastic sheet, is placed on the top surface of the printing platform 10 on the worktable 1. The external vacuum generator is started, and the vacuum generator draws negative pressure into the cavity inside the printing platform 10 through the connecting air pipe. The negative pressure in the cavity acts on the substrate through the evenly distributed vacuum adsorption holes 101 on the top surface, tightly adsorbing the substrate onto the platform surface and preventing the substrate from shifting due to scraping by the squeegee or movement of the mechanism during the printing process.

[0016] like Figure 2 As shown, sliding plates 11 are slidably mounted on both sides of the mounting plate 6 via slide rails. The top of one sliding plate 11 is connected to the telescopic rod of the electric push rod 7, and the bottom of the sliding plate 11 is connected to the mounting housing 81. The bottom of the other sliding plate 11 is connected to the ink return plate assembly 9. In use, the telescopic rod of the electric push rod 7 drives the corresponding sliding plate 11 to move up and down along the slide rails on both sides of the mounting plate 6. The sliding plates 11 are connected to the squeegee assembly 8 and the ink return plate assembly 9 respectively, thereby adjusting the contact pressure between the squeegee 82, the ink return plate and the screen printing plate 5 (the greater the pressure, the less ink is transferred; the lower the pressure, the more ink is transferred), and cooperating with the squeegee angle to achieve dual control of printing thickness.

[0017] like Figure 3 As shown, the scraper assembly 8 includes a mounting shell 81 with an opening at the bottom. A scraper 82 is housed inside the mounting shell 81 and is rotatably mounted within it via a rotating shaft at the top. A worm gear 83 is fixedly positioned at the center of the rotating shaft of the scraper 82. A worm 84 is connected above the worm gear 83 via a transmission connection and is rotatably mounted within the mounting shell 81. A drive motor 85 connected to the worm 84 is mounted on the outer surface of the mounting shell 81. When the printing thickness needs to be adjusted, the drive motor 85 of the scraper assembly 8 is activated, causing the drive motor 85 to move the worm 84 within the mounting shell 81. The worm gear 84 rotates inside the housing 81. Because the worm 84 meshes with the worm wheel 83 on the rotating shaft of the scraper 82, the rotation of the worm 84 is converted into the low-speed rotation of the worm wheel 83, which in turn drives the scraper 82 to tilt around the rotating shaft (increasing the tilt angle can reduce the amount of ink scraped, and decreasing the angle can increase the amount of ink scraped), so as to achieve precise adjustment of the scraper angle. In addition, the worm gear and worm wheel combination used in this utility model also has a self-locking function. The self-locking function can prevent the scraper 82 from shifting its angle due to the contact pressure during scraping, mechanism vibration or its own gravity, so as to stably maintain the preset printing thickness parameters.

[0018] Once the parameters are adjusted, the screw drive mechanism of the lateral movement component 3 is activated, driving the moving plate 32 to move laterally at a constant speed along the sliding guide rail 31; the moving plate 32 drives the mounting plate 6 to move laterally synchronously, and the mounting plate 6 drives the scraper assembly 8 and the ink return plate assembly 9 to move along the surface of the screen printing plate 5 via the sliding plate 11. The squeegee 82 first contacts the screen printing plate 5. During the lateral movement, it scrapes the ink on the screen printing plate 5 along the mesh to the surface of the substrate below, forming a printing layer of a preset thickness. The ink return plate assembly 9 moves synchronously with the squeegee 82. After the squeegee finishes scraping, the ink return plate scrapes the remaining ink on the screen printing plate 5 back in the initial direction, so that the ink is redistributed evenly on the screen printing plate, preparing for the next printing.

[0019] After a single printing is completed, the horizontal moving component 3 drives the moving plate 32 to return to its initial position, and the vertical moving component 2 drives the horizontal moving component 3 to rise and detach from the substrate; the vacuum generator stops working, the negative pressure on the substrate platform 10 disappears, the operator removes the printed substrate, and the device enters the next printing cycle.
